Opt-out deadline tomorrow

By Sue Favor on Thursday, June 25, 2020

WNBA players have until tomorrow to opt out of the 2020 season

WNBA team news:

The Dream signed Betnijah Laney and Jaylyn Agnew.

WNBA player news:

Some stars are skipping the season due to coronavirus concerns, and social justice reform.

Sun vets Jasmine Thomas and Alyssa Thomas are eager to start the season, despite the uncertainty around it.

Q&A with Erica Wheeler.

Q&A with Aerial Powers.

Mikayla Pivec is serving her community during the pandemic.

College team news:

The UConn-Texas series has been pushed back a year.

College coach news:

Rick Insell’s passion remains the same at Middle Tennessee.

Lisa Bluder looks back on her 20 years at Iowa’s head coach.

Courtney Banghart interview.
